How to Remove Black Permanent Ink From Carpet

Black ink on carpet can be a nightmare, particularly if the carpet is light in color. Remember to test in a small are that is not readily visible, to ensure that "cleaning" the carpet will not actually make the stain worse. Does this Spark an idea?

Things You'll Need

  • Hairspray
  • Warm water
  • Vinegar
  • Medium stiffness brush
  • Old rag
Show More

Instructions

    • 1

      Spray the stained area liberally with hairspray. Allow the hairspray to dry completely.

    • 2

      Mix a cup of warm water with a drop of vinegar. Pour a small amount on the marker stain.

    • 3

      Scrub the area with a brush that has medium stiff bristles.

    • 4

      Blot the stained area with an old rag until the carpet is dry. If any of the stain remains, repeat the process.
